Sales Force Automation Software
Sales force automation software is software that is automated to complete sales-oriented CRM tasks for companies, businesses, or independent sales-people. Often, these types of programs are of the CRM type, and are made to process and utilize information put into then. This could be information like addresses, E-mail addresses, text message addresses, telephone numbers, or anything like this.
Here is a quick example of what sales force automation software might do. Take, for example, a company that puts on concerts. Well, this company, which is basically a concert-promotion company, might make use of this automation process in several ways. First off, they might get text message numbers from fans who join their texting club.
When they do, the numbers are processed by the automated system, and welcome messages are sent out. Now, all that the company has to do is tell the system what the monthly, bi-monthly, or even weekly messages are going to say. The messages are then sent out automatically, thus why they are called sales force automation software.
Sales force automation software can also operate on the level of targeted E-mail marketing. Basically, potential customers are reached via email in the same way as they are by text message. This is a much more common example… most companies now have an email newsletter, while text message alerts are also common, albeit a bit more on the rare side.
